Ralph Martindale & Co Ltd v. Harris - Selection for redundancy [2007] EAT
Martindale needed to make redundancies. Two managers, one of which was Mr Harris, were at risk; a single new post was created, and opened to an internal competition. Mr Harris was unsuccessful. An employment tribunal found the dismissal unfair - the criteria to select between the two were totally subjective, and with two people at risk of redundancy the new role should have been opened to further applicants only once it was clear that neither was suitable.
